Executive summary

Applied Systems is highly likely to be cited by AI engines for evaluation-stage queries because it has strong G2 presence (1,652 reviews, 4.4/5, Grid Leader) and an active LinkedIn company authority signal (51,061 followers). The biggest citation risk is evaluation queries that require first-party, crawlable comparison/pricing content (e.g., “[Applied Systems] vs [competitor]” and “Applied Systems pricing”); the site appears to rely heavily on contact-gated flows and lacks easily discoverable SoftwareApplication/FAQPage structured-data signals in public search results.
